ScotRail provides nearly 100 million passenger journeys each year, with over 2,300 intercity, regional and suburban rail services a day, more than 340 stations, and just under 800 trains serving Scotland's railway. The ScotRail network is vital to Scotland's communities, and to the country's booming tourist industry.

With over 5,000 employees, based across Scotland, we are a large employer with a proud history. But there’s more to ScotRail than you think.

Your health, wellbeing and benefits

Everyone across Scotland’s Railway plays a key role in developing, reinforcing, and changing the culture of our organisation. We know they can only perform at their best if we look after their well-being, from physical and mental health through to the training and development opportunities they have.

We want our employees to be healthy, happy and inspired.

We have a range of benefits including:

  • Free rail travel on all ScotRail services for you, your partner and children
  • Discounted travel on national and international rail services for you, your partner and children
  • Discounted ‘Friends and Family’ rail tickets for ScotRail services
  • Defined Pension Benefit Scheme from day one
  • Employee Assistance Programme, giving free and confidential advice to colleagues
  • Mental Health First Aiders
  • Maternity/ Paternity leave
  • Discounted shopping on lots of high street stores and discounted tickets on days out
  • Access to the Transport Credit Union
  • Annual cycle to work discount scheme
  • One volunteering day a year, paid
  • Match funding for any charity fundraising
  • Generous annual leave allocation
  • Automatic entry to Healthshield, giving you money back on things like dental treatment and podiatry
  • Employee Recognition scheme for those going the extra mile
